      i’ll elaborate on the PBX categories:

      when we fill out all the fields in the game list manager its creating a XML file
      and when we bring up the category menu while in PBX and say we pick 80’s
      PBX goes and look at all the XML files in the database and brings up anything thats has 198* in it…
      or the limited list of manufacturers
      so if it can pull from the XML database it should be able to pull from any part of the information inputted into the game list manager (XML file)
      customized categories would be more decades, manufacturers,  EM or SS  <—this is all standard info in the XML
      other customized thing i would want are the top ten tables most played

                              Lol! I was about to ask…did you drain all of Sony’s inventory?  :)

                              So your cameras needed that IR filter removed from inside the lens? I’ve seen some messy pics of people hacking those things up to do that!

                              For me, the newer camera just needed an IR “Pass” filter put in front of the lens that allowed “only” IR light to be seen by the lens. I just used the red and blue plastic transparent filter from old red/blue 3d glasses, and just inserted them into the lens cover. They combine to make a good IR pass filter! No mods needed.

                              This is similar in principle to what Oculus does for the VR camera that sees the IR diodes on the headset.
